Tresind Mumbai
This multi-award-winning restaurant was born in Dubai with the mission of honouring Indian cuisine's rich history through creative takes on traditional dishes. A delicious 14-course chef's tasting menu, including local cuisines, is available at Trèsind Mumbai. They switch up their exclusive tasting menu every three to four months, so you can always look forward to something new. Past tasting menu highlights include the Arugula Pani Puri with Feta Cream and Poached Pears, Chaat Mille-feuille with Pumpkin Blossom and Togarashi, and Gujarati Farsan Ice Cream, among others.

Indian Accent
Indian Accent is all about creative flavours and dishes served in a distinctive way. Some of their innovative creations are the Tofu Medu Vadai with Gunpowder and Sambar Cream, the Meetha Aachar Pork Ribs with Green Apple, or the Stuffed Morel, Gobindobhog and Mushroom Payesh with Summer Truffles.
Here, you can enjoy a meal that seamlessly blends traditional Indian flavours with sophisticated global techniques. The Aab Gosht, usually a Kashmiri lamb dish, is presented here as a dumpling with rice puffs, and Mishti Doi is served within a cannoli to make a novel display! Talk about creativity.
Tevar
One of the newest restaurants in Hyderabad, Tevar serves up contemporary Indian cuisine in an opulent setting. An Achappam Chaat, Kale Patta Chaat, Arbi ki Gilavat, Cajun Lamb Seekh Kebab, Avocado Kulfi, Mysore Pak Snickers, and more creative interpretations of traditional Indian dishes are available on the wide menu.
Thalipeeth, Gomantak Surmai Curry, Assam Black Chicken, Thalassery Chicken Biryani, Tibetan Tingmo, Khamiri Roti, and North Indian and Mughlai cuisines are only a few examples of the many Indian regional specialities offered. Ziya, The Oberoi
The "evolved Indian cuisine" served at this fine dine restaurant has made it rather famous. Modern takes on classic subcontinental dishes are served here and are enjoyed by regulars with much aplomb. Their Malai-Kashmiri Chilli Lobster, Charcoal Prawns with Pindi Hummus, Tandoori Aloo with Tahini and Pomegranate Tabbouleh, Chocomosa with Kapi Shrikhand, and Rajasthani Lamb Chops are all delicious options.
